Skip to content

Commit c03e9d6

Browse files
committed
fix: relations batch update using model key name, instead of controller's key name
1 parent df51990 commit c03e9d6

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/Concerns/HandlesRelationStandardBatchOperations.php

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-126,7 +126,7 @@ public function batchUpdate(Request $request, $parentKey)
126126
/** @var Model $entity */
127127
$this->authorize('update', $entity);
128128

129-
$resource = $request->input("resources.{$entity->getKey()}");
129+
$resource = $request->input("resources.{$entity->{$this->keyName()}}");
130130

131131
$this->beforeUpdate($request, $entity);
132132
$this->beforeSave($request, $entity);
@@ -547,4 +547,4 @@ protected function afterBatchRestore(Request $request, Collection $entities)
547547
{
548548
return null;
549549
}
550-
}
550+
}

0 commit comments

Comments
 (0)